Embracing The Star’s Radiant Energies

The Star card, numbered 17 in the Major Arcana, traditionally depicts a naked woman kneeling by a pool of water, pouring water from two pitchers. One foot rests on the water, connecting her to intuition and the subconscious, while the other is on land, symbolizing her grounding in reality. Above her, a large star, surrounded by seven smaller stars, shines brightly, representing hope, inspiration, and our connection to the cosmos. This imagery alone suggests a beautiful blend of earthly and spiritual wisdom.

Its essence is pure, unadulterated hope and a profound sense of renewal. After the turmoil that might be represented by cards like The Tower, The Star emerges as a balm for the soul, promising a future filled with calm and clarity.

The Shadowed Glimmer: Decoding The Star Reversed

In its upright position, The Star offers a soothing balm of cosmic reassurance. Reversed, however, this profound card speaks to moments when that divine connection feels distant, when the well of inspiration seems to have run dry, and a pervasive sense of despair begins to creep in. It often manifests as a feeling of being adrift, detached from the very forces that usually bring renewal and serenity.

“The reversed Star isn’t an absence of light; it’s a call to find the switch in the darkness. It’s about remembering your inherent capacity for hope, even when it feels like it’s been lost.”

Loss of Hope and Lingering Despair

One of the most prominent themes of The Star Reversed is a profound lack of hope. Where the upright Star promises a guiding light, its reversal can leave you feeling as though that light has flickered out. Clients often describe feeling a deep sense of despair, a cynicism that colors every outlook. It might be a persistent feeling that things won’t get better, or an inability to envision a positive future. This isn’t just sadness; it’s a weariness of the spirit that makes even small acts of optimism feel impossible. It’s important to acknowledge this feeling without judgment, understanding it as a temporary state that tarot is helping you identify.

Spiritual Disconnection and Inner Emptiness

The Star is intrinsically linked to our spiritual path and connection to the divine. When reversed, it signals a significant spiritual disconnection. You might feel a void, an inner emptiness where once there was a sense of purpose or belonging. This isn’t necessarily about religious belief, but about a loss of faith in something larger than yourself, or a feeling of being cut off from your intuition. Many experience this as a longing for meaning, yet an inability to grasp it, leaving them feeling profoundly isolated even amidst company.

Creative Blocks and Vanished Inspiration

Creativity and inspiration are gifts of The Star. In reversal, these energies are stifled, leading to significant creative blocks. Artists, writers, or anyone whose work relies on a spark of ingenuity might find themselves staring at a blank page or a stagnant project, feeling that their muse has vanished without a trace. This can extend beyond artistic endeavors; it can mean feeling uninspired in problem-solving, lacking innovative ideas at work, or simply losing the zest for activities that once brought joy. The flow is interrupted, and new ideas seem far out of reach.

Overwhelmed by Negativity and Self-Doubt

Finally, The Star Reversed often points to being overwhelmed by negativity and debilitating self-doubt. The serenity and confidence of the upright card are replaced by a barrage of critical thoughts and feelings of inadequacy. This can make decision-making difficult, as you second-guess every instinct. It fosters a cycle where negativity feeds more negativity, creating a heavy burden on your spirit. Recognizing this pattern is the first step towards breaking free from its grasp.

Drawing Wisdom from the Depths of The Star Reversed

When The Star appears reversed, it signals more than just a temporary dip in spirits; it’s an invitation to look deeper. This isn’t about ignoring the difficulties, but recognizing what profound growth can arise from them.

Inherent Strengths from the Shadow

It might seem counterintuitive, but facing the absence of light can forge incredible inner fortitude. Many clients I’ve guided through this energy emerge with newfound strengths, far more grounded than before.

  • Resilience: When external sources of hope diminish, you’re compelled to tap into your own inner reserves. It’s like a plant that, deprived of sunlight, sends its roots deeper into the earth in search of sustenance. This period forces you to discover a resilience you never knew you possessed.
  • A Deeper Push for Internal Light: This is a crucial turning point. Instead of seeking validation or inspiration solely from the outside world, The Star reversed nudges you inward. It asks you to become your own beacon. For some, this journey of introspection is mirrored by The Hermit, guiding them to seek wisdom from within. It’s about cultivating your personal source of peace and meaning.
  • Self-Reliance: When the usual channels of support or motivation seem blocked, you learn to trust your own judgment and capabilities. This isn’t isolation in a negative sense, but a powerful reclamation of your autonomy. You become the architect of your own path, rather than passively waiting for external guidance.
  • Grounded Realism: Sometimes, the upright Star can bring a touch of idealism that borders on unrealistic expectation. When reversed, it strips away illusions, forcing a more practical and honest assessment of your situation. This grounded perspective, though initially tough, prevents future disappointments and helps you build a more sustainable foundation for your dreams.

I recall a client, Sarah, who pulled The Star reversed during a period of intense career disillusionment. She felt utterly lost, her grand visions crumbling. Yet, through her struggle, she honed an incredible ability to discern genuine opportunities from fleeting fancies, and built her next venture on a foundation of solid, actionable steps rather than pure idealism.

Navigating the Challenges of The Star Reversed

While strengths emerge, it’s equally important to acknowledge the very real challenges this reversed energy presents. Forewarned is forearmed.

  • Burnout: Constantly feeling a lack of inspiration or hope can be emotionally and mentally exhausting. The effort to simply function can drain your reserves, leading to deep fatigue. This isn’t just physical tiredness; it’s a profound weariness of the spirit.
  • Overwhelming Cynicism: A prolonged period of feeling disconnected or purposeless can breed a pervasive sense of cynicism. You might find yourself questioning everything, distrusting intentions, and dismissing positive possibilities, making it harder to embrace the very healing The Star energy offers.
  • Isolation: When hope fades and inspiration eludes, the natural inclination can be to retreat. This self-imposed isolation, while sometimes necessary for introspection, can quickly become a trap, cutting you off from potential support and external perspectives.
  • Prolonged Creative Stagnation: For those whose work or joy is tied to creativity, The Star reversed can feel like a devastating block. Ideas don’t flow, projects feel overwhelming, and the joy of creation seems distant, leading to frustration and self-doubt.
  • Difficulty Envisioning a Positive Future: Perhaps the most poignant challenge is the inability to see beyond the current gloom. The once bright future becomes a blurry, uncertain canvas, making it hard to set goals or find motivation.

Understanding these dynamics is your first step. It’s not about succumbing to the challenges, but rather recognizing them for what they are: temporary states that, with awareness, can be transformed. By acknowledging both the shadows and the surprising lights within this cosmic storm, you’re better equipped to weather it and emerge with deeper wisdom and an authentic, self-generated glow. FAQs

Is The Star Reversed always a negative omen?
Not at all! While it highlights challenges, The Star Reversed often serves as a powerful call to action for self-reflection and rediscovering inner strength. It signals a need to address internal blocks rather than an inescapable doom.

How can I find hope again when feeling disconnected?
Begin by reconnecting with simple joys and acts of self-care. Engage in creative pursuits, spend time in nature, or seek out supportive friends. Even small steps towards nurturing your spirit can reignite your inner light.

What if I feel completely overwhelmed by The Star Reversed?
It’s crucial to acknowledge these feelings without judgment. Break down overwhelming tasks into smaller, manageable steps. Consider meditation, journaling, or talking to a trusted advisor to help process your emotions and find clarity.

Are there any specific affirmations that can help with The Star Reversed?
Absolutely! Try affirmations like “I am worthy of hope and inspiration,” “I trust my inner guidance to light my way,” or “I am resilient and capable of overcoming challenges.” Repeat them daily to shift your mindset.

How can I identify if The Star Reversed truly applies to my situation?
Reflect on whether you’re experiencing feelings of hopelessness, creative stagnation, spiritual disconnection, or persistent negativity. If these resonate, The Star Reversed offers a framework for understanding and addressing these aspects of your life.
